Eva Kiviat's love affair with a cappella began her first week of college and she's never looked back. Eva was the music director and primary arranger for Binghamton University's Kaskeset, a Jewish-themed, mixed a cappella group. She remains an active arranger for the group and all-around a cappella fan! Before entering the a cappella world, Eva spent most of her time studying multiple instruments with renowned instructors from Juilliard, Manhattan School of Music and The Stecher and Horowitz School of the Arts. Her primary instruments are violin, flute and piano. She also plays 'cello, trumpet, ukulele, bass and accordion. Eva remains an active teacher and performer. She received her graduate training from Long Island University, CW Post Campus in Music Education and Speech-Language Pathology.Ms. Kiviat works as an Elementary School Orchestra Teacher, Speech Language Pathologist and as an a cappella arranger. She also teaches math verbal and writing skills through Kaplan Higher Education, helping students master the elements of the GRE, GMAT and SAT. Eva volunteers for the Stecher and Horowitz Foundation, a non-profit committed to furthering the education, recognition and fostering of the next generation of classical musicians. Finally, when the summer months arrive, Eva is a Camp Director at one of New York's premiere Rock Music Programs where she is Rock Band Coach, bass and keyboard instructor and leader of vocal workshops.
